A simple recipe for perfectly crispy, tangy homemade dill pickle chips that are quick to make and perfect for snacking or parties.
Keep pickles dry before coating to ensure crispiness. Maintain oil temperature at 350°F to avoid soggy or greasy chips. Fry in small batches to keep oil temperature steady. For extra crispiness, double dip in egg wash and flour. Baking is an alternative but yields less crispy chips.
